Director Rian Johnson of Knives Out recently broke out that Apple does not allow bad guys to use iPhones in movies, a kind of revelation that may spoil the whole fun of watching detective movies when you can tell who is good and who is bad by looking at the kind of phones they use.

Johnson said this in a scene breakdown video about his movie Knives Out for Vanity Fair. He also mentioned some interesting details about Apple’s strict policy when it comes to using its products in movies.

Johnson did hesitate a bit before spill this out as it might bring him lots of trouble when directing the next mystery movie, but he said it anyway. Apple lets movie characters use its smartphones but no villain can be caught on the camera using an iPhone.

Johnson went on joking that other directors would want to murder him for breaking this vital piece of information to the public as now they would have a hard time concealing who is the bad guy now.

While it might come as a surprise, this practice is not new. Nearly two decades ago, all the terrorists on the American show 24 used Windows while the heroes have Macs.

The reason behind this ban is unknown but it can be as simple as Apple is more careful about product placement than other smartphone vendors.

Of course, many have suspected the existence of such a policy but it was not until Johnson confirmed Apple’s restriction that they had concrete evidence to back their theory.
